| // Converts a YUV video frame to RGB format and stores the results in the |
| // provided mailbox. The caller of this function maintains ownership of the |
| // mailbox. Automatically handles upload of CPU memory backed VideoFrames in |
| // I420 format. VideoFrames that wrap external textures can be I420 or NV12 |
| // format. |
| MEDIA_EXPORT void ConvertFromVideoFrameYUV( |
| const VideoFrame* video_frame, |
| viz::RasterContextProvider* raster_context_provider, |
| const gpu::MailboxHolder& dest_mailbox_holder); |
